How To Fix PIC01803 - Selected quantity is greater than available quantity


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: PIC01 - Parts Interchangeability Message Class

  • Message number: 803

  • Message text: Selected quantity is greater than available quantity

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message PIC01803 - Selected quantity is greater than available quantity ?

    The SAP error message PIC01803 indicates that the selected quantity for a particular item exceeds the available quantity in stock. This error typically occurs in scenarios such as sales order processing, inventory management, or production planning when attempting to allocate or reserve more items than are available.

    Cause:

    1. Insufficient Stock: The most common cause is that the quantity you are trying to process (e.g., in a sales order or production order) is greater than what is currently available in inventory.
    2. Incorrect Data Entry: There may be a mistake in the quantity entered, either by the user or due to a system error.
    3. Stock Movements: Recent stock movements (goods receipts, goods issues, etc.) may not have been updated in the system, leading to discrepancies in available quantities.
    4. Batch Management: If batch management is enabled, the specific batch may not have enough stock available.
    5. Reservation Issues: If there are existing reservations for the stock that are not accounted for, this can lead to the error.

    Solution:

    1. Check Available Stock: Verify the available stock for the item in question using transaction codes like MMBE (Stock Overview) or MB52 (List Warehouse Stocks on Hand).
    2. Adjust Quantity: If the available stock is indeed less than the requested quantity, adjust the quantity in your transaction to match the available stock.
    3. Update Stock: If stock has recently been received but not updated, ensure that all goods receipts are processed and that the inventory is updated.
    4. Review Reservations: Check for any existing reservations that may be consuming the available stock. You can use transaction code MB22 to view and manage reservations.
    5. Batch Check: If batch management is in use, ensure that the specific batch has enough stock available.
    6. Consult with Inventory Management: If you are unsure about stock levels or reservations, consult with your inventory management team to get a clearer picture of stock availability.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es such as:
      • MMBE: Stock Overview
      • MB52: List Warehouse Stocks on Hand
      • MB22: Change Reservation
      • MB1A: Goods Issue
      • MB1B: Transfer Posting
    • User Roles: Ensure that you have the necessary permissions to view stock levels and make adjustments.
    •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or your organization's internal guidelines for handling stock discrepancies and error messages.

    By following these steps, you should be able to resolve the PIC01803 error and proceed with your transaction.
